What Types of Horses are Commonly Available in Los Angeles?

Los Angeles boasts a diverse equestrian scene, meaning you'll find a broad selection of horses for sale. From seasoned show jumpers to gentle trail horses, the options are plentiful. Common breeds available include:

  • Quarter Horses: Popular for their versatility in various disciplines, including Western riding, ranch work, and even English riding styles.
  • Warmbloods: Often favored for their athleticism and suitability for dressage, jumping, and eventing.
  • Thoroughbreds: Known for their speed and stamina, many retired racehorses find new homes as versatile riding horses.
  • Arabians: Prized for their beauty, intelligence, and endurance, making them excellent choices for both pleasure riding and competitive disciplines.
  • Andalusian: Graceful and elegant, frequently sought after for dressage and other disciplines requiring elegance and precision.

Where Can I Find Horses for Sale in Los Angeles?

Several avenues exist for finding horses for sale in the Los Angeles area:

  • Online Marketplaces: Websites like Craigslist, Facebook Marketplace, and specialized equestrian websites often list horses for sale. Be sure to thoroughly vet sellers and horses before making any commitments.
  • Local Equestrian Centers and Boarding Facilities: Many stables and riding centers in the Los Angeles area may have horses for sale or can connect you with owners looking to sell.
  • Breed-Specific Organizations: Connecting with breed associations can be valuable, as they often have member listings or can direct you towards reputable breeders or sellers.
  • Horse Shows and Events: Attending local horse shows and competitions provides an excellent opportunity to network with owners and see horses in action.

What Should I Consider When Buying a Horse in Los Angeles?

Buying a horse is a significant investment, both financially and emotionally. Several crucial factors to consider include:

  • Your Riding Experience: Be realistic about your skill level and choose a horse that matches your capabilities. A beginner should avoid a high-spirited or inexperienced horse.
  • Your Riding Goals: What do you hope to accomplish with your horse? Trail riding? Dressage? Jumping? Your goals will dictate the type of horse you need.
  • Budget: Horses represent a significant financial commitment, including purchase price, boarding, feed, veterinary care, farrier, and equipment.
  • Veterinary Check-Up: Always have a pre-purchase veterinary examination conducted by an experienced equine veterinarian. This is crucial for identifying any potential health issues.

What are the typical costs associated with buying a horse in Los Angeles?

The price of horses in Los Angeles varies greatly depending on breed, age, training, and experience. Expect to pay anywhere from a few thousand dollars for a less experienced horse to tens of thousands for a highly trained show horse. Remember that ongoing costs will significantly add to the initial purchase price.

What are the common health concerns of horses in the Los Angeles area?

As with any region, horses in Los Angeles can be susceptible to various health issues. These can include common ailments such as colic, respiratory problems, and lameness. A thorough pre-purchase veterinary examination is critical to identify any existing or potential health problems.

How can I find a reputable seller or trainer in the Los Angeles area?

Finding a reputable seller is key to a successful purchase. Ask for references, check online reviews, and visit the horse in its current environment to assess its temperament and handling. Working with an experienced equine trainer can also offer guidance and support throughout the process.
